More Premium Hugo Themes Premium Vue Themes

Vite Plugin Vue2 Svg

load SVG files as Vue components, for Vue2.x only.

Vite Plugin Vue2 Svg

load SVG files as Vue components, for Vue2.x only.

Author Avatar Theme by pakholeung37
Github Stars Github Stars: 19
Last Commit Last Commit: Feb 23, 2023 -
First Commit Created: Aug 8, 2025 -
Vite Plugin Vue2 Svg screenshot

Overview

Vite-plugin-vue2-svgload is a powerful tool specifically designed for Vue 2.x applications that enables developers to seamlessly use SVG files as Vue components. This plugin simplifies the handling of SVG graphics, offering a streamlined approach to incorporate scalable vector graphics into your Vue projects.

With the growing popularity of SVGs for graphical content due to their scalability and versatility, this plugin is a valuable asset for developers looking to enhance their applications with visually appealing elements without compromising performance.

Features

  • Vue Component Integration: Easily import SVG files as Vue components, allowing for more flexible and dynamic graphical elements within your application.
  • Simplicity in Usage: Streamlined setup process with clear installation instructions, making it easy for developers to get started quickly.
  • File Specific Disable Options: Need to disable the plugin for a particular SVG file? Simply add ?raw to your import statement for flexibility.
  • Optimized for Vue 2.x: Specifically built for Vue 2.x applications, ensuring compatibility and optimal performance with this version.
  • Open Source License: Released under the MIT License, promoting community collaboration and transparency.